粉煤灰处理含氟废水单因素实验研究

摘    要:为处理含氟废水,本实验采用粉煤灰作为吸附材料,并进行了影响粉煤灰处理含氟废水的各种单因素条件下的实验.结果表明最佳处理条件是pH值为3,水灰比小于11:1,振荡时间为135min,氟浓度小于400mg/L.在此条件下对400mg/L的含氟废水可达到94%以上的去除率.粉煤灰对处置含氟废水是一个很好的吸附材料,但除氟后饱和灰的处置也应引起重视.

A Single-Factor Experimental Study on the Treatment for Containing Fluoride Wastewater by Fly Ash

Abstract:In this paper,fly ash was applied to remove the fluoride of wastewater and every single-factor experiment was done,which influenced the removal ratio of fluoride.It showed that the optimal conditions were as follows: the pH of waster was adjusted to 3,ration of wastewater and fly ash was controlled at less than 11:1,equilibrium time was 135min and concentration of fluoride removed was less than 400mg/L.A removal percentage of 94% or more was attained under the optimal conditions to remove the fluoride of 400mg/L wastewater.In a word,fly ash is a good material for removing the containing fluoride wastewater and the treatment for containing fluoride ash should be completely taken into accountant.
